SFO ended arms probe after Saudi threat

By Megan Murphy, Law Courts Correspondent The Serious Fraud Office was told it would not be able to persuade Saudi Arabia to withdraw a threat to cease co-operation with the UK on counter-terrorism just weeks before it abandoned a high-profile corruption probe into arms deals between the two countries. Evidence submitted to the House of Lords on Monday reveals Britain’s ambassador to Saudi Arabia warned senior SFO officials – including Robert Wardle, the agency’s former head – that the Saudis did not understand the fraud office was independent of...
